Summary

The Badger is back!

In the middle of a gang war, wanted for murder, truly alone and outside the law, Detective Inspector LeBrock is on the run from both the police and gangster assassins, the victim of a diabolical scheme to annihilate himself and everyone he holds dear, engineered by mastermind crime lord Tiberius Koenig, one of the most despicable villains in the history of detective fiction.

A graphic novel built on the solid foundation of a strong story. – Philip PullmanThe latest and last in the sequence Grandville Force Majeure is an epic of anthropomorphised sex and violence featuring a huge cast of badgers (including our hero Detective Inspector LeBrock), lizards, rats and even a Dalmation. It’s a heady mix of Holmesian ratiocination and SF steampunk technology straight out of a Jules Verne novel, lashed to a story that takes in gang violence, freemasons and secret identities. And it’s so slick. Talbot’s great facility as a comic artist gives his narrative extra oomph. The result is fast-moving and hugely entertaining. – Teddy Jamieson * Herald Scotland *Exceeds the standards… Of all in its league. * Blouin Artinfo *

About The Author

Bryan Talbot

Bryan Talbot was born in 1952. He has worked on underground comics, science fiction and superhero stories such as Judge Dredd and Batman- Legends of the Dark Knight. His books include Alice in Sunderland, Dotter of Her Father’s Eyes (with Mary Talbot), the first graphic novel to win the Costa biography award, and the Grandville series.
